NYC boosts number of appointment slots for residential ID card after surge in demand

[ad_1]

A person sits in front a white screen waiting for their picture to be taken for an IDNYC card.

The city says it will be releasing 300 more appointments each week.

City officials say they’re releasing more appointments every week to meet demand. [ more › ]
